Lothar Matthäus compares Jamal Musiala to Lionel Messi

Speaking on Sky Germany following Bayern Munich’s 2-0 win against Schalke on Saturday evening, Lothar Matthäus reserved the highest of praise for 19-year-old Jamal Musiala.

“When you see what he’s doing here, the heel flick to Gnabry [for 1-0] and the pass to Choupo-Moting [for 2-0], it enchants us all,” said Matthäus. “He just entertains us. This is Hollywood. I want to see this player on the pitch every time. What he did is magic. This is Messi-like. It’s crazy, this man must never leave Bavaria.”

When asked how much it would take for Bayern to sell Musiala, Matthäus said: “I say quarter of a billion. He’s not for sale. This player has to stay with Bayern.”

Musiala also received praise from Bayern head coach Julian Nagelsmann: “He listens well and he wants to develop. He’s also improved a lot when it comes to defensive diligence.

“He played an outstanding first half of the season and will hopefully play the World Cup and the second half of the season the same way. Basically, only an injury can stop him otherwise he will continue to perform as he has in the last few weeks.”

Musiala’s appearance for Bayern Munich on Saturday was his 100th for the Rekordmeister. Already this season the 19-year-old has a goal contribution of 22 (12 goals, 10 assists) in 22 games across all competitions. In 100 games, Musiala has 27 goals and 17 assists.

With 17 caps already for Germany, Musiala has made Hansi Flick’s 26-man squad for the World Cup. Die Mannschaft start their tournament against Japan on November 23 before games against Spain and Costa Rica.
